Understanding the Mechanics of Kalshi Contracts

At the heart of the kalshi system lies the concept of contracts tied to specific events. These aren’t contracts in the traditional, legal sense, but rather financial instruments that represent a stake in the probability of an outcome. For instance, a contract might exist for “Who will win the 2024 US Presidential Election?” or “Will global temperatures exceed a certain threshold in the next five years?” Users can buy 'yes' contracts, betting that the event will happen, or 'no' contracts, betting that it won't. The price of these contracts fluctuates based on supply and demand, reflecting the collective belief of market participants. The closer an event is, and the more confidence the market has in its outcome, the more a 'yes' or 'no' contract will cost, respectively. The key is that these contracts are resolved based on objective, verifiable data sources, ensuring fairness and transparency. This verifiable nature is critical for building trust and credibility within the system.

Liquidity and Market Depth

A crucial factor for the success of any exchange, including kalshi, is liquidity. Liquidity refers to the ease with which contracts can be bought and sold without significantly impacting the price. Higher liquidity generally means tighter spreads, lower transaction costs, and a more efficient market. Kalshi actively works to foster liquidity through various mechanisms, including attracting a diverse user base, providing incentives for market makers, and ensuring a user-friendly trading interface. Market depth, another related concept, refers to the volume of buy and sell orders available at different price levels. Greater market depth indicates a more robust and resilient market, less susceptible to manipulation. A shallow market can experience significant price swings with relatively small trades.

The Regulatory Landscape of Prediction Markets

Prediction markets occupy a unique and often ambiguous space within the financial regulatory framework. Traditional exchanges are subject to stringent regulations designed to protect investors and prevent fraud. However, the novelty of platforms like kalshi has presented challenges for regulators, who are grappling with how best to oversee these emerging markets. The Commodity Futures Trading Commission (CFTC) in the United States has been particularly active in analyzing and regulating kalshi, granting it a Designated Contract Market (DCM) license, which allows it to offer certain types of event-based contracts. This license comes with responsibilities, including ensuring market integrity, preventing manipulation, and providing transparency to participants. Regulatory scrutiny is expected to increase as the markets grow in popularity and sophistication. The challenge for regulators is to strike a balance between fostering innovation and protecting market participants.

Navigating the Legal Hurdles

One of the major hurdles facing prediction markets is the potential for them to be classified as illegal gambling. This concern stems from the fact that contracts are essentially bets on future outcomes. However, proponents argue that prediction markets are fundamentally different from traditional gambling because they are based on objective data and analysis, rather than pure chance. Furthermore, they contend that prediction markets provide valuable information and can enhance decision-making. Despite these arguments, legal challenges persist in some jurisdictions. The classification and regulation of these markets vary significantly across different countries and regions, creating a complex legal landscape for operators and users. Understanding these legal nuances is paramount to navigating this space effectively.

The Influence of Collective Intelligence

The underlying principle behind kalshi’s success is the power of collective intelligence. This concept, popularized by James Surowieki in his book The Wisdom of Crowds, suggests that the aggregated judgments of a diverse group of individuals are often more accurate than those of individual experts. In the context of kalshi, the market price of a contract reflects the combined knowledge and expectations of all participants. This collective wisdom is constantly updated as new information becomes available, leading to increasingly accurate forecasts. The platform’s design encourages participation from a wide range of individuals, ensuring that diverse perspectives are represented. The anonymity of trading also minimizes biases and allows participants to express their true beliefs without fear of social pressure.
